lots of the marks for the anthology question are for comparisons so as long as you know key themes for the poems and be able to make links between poems with similar themes, as well as pointing out any differences, you should be fine. While analysis is ofc v important the question word is compare so it's good to know just a few poems well that can be compared fairly universally if you're struggling with remembering all 15 poems, but make sure you've at least briefly looked over each poem in case it comes up so you don't end up treating it like an unseen
